Output d3efa72fd87787465cb29ab639be62dd7e8860ff6a3e1683aa468379745cb060:1

value
70000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c80b8bcccbb7261319a233dc49dfc918da99b2e OP_EQUAL
address
3Baj6zneeWimdzLL7JEDSHNFzHN6FWX7DF
transaction
d3efa72fd87787465cb29ab639be62dd7e8860ff6a3e1683aa468379745cb060